svn commit: r652190 - /ofbiz/trunk/applications/product/script/org/ofbiz/product/inventory/InventoryReserveServices.xml

Previous Topic Next Topic
 
classic Classic list List threaded Threaded
1 message Options
Reply | Threaded
Open this post in threaded view
|

svn commit: r652190 - /ofbiz/trunk/applications/product/script/org/ofbiz/product/inventory/InventoryReserveServices.xml

jacopoc
Author: jacopoc
Date: Tue Apr 29 16:51:23 2008
New Revision: 652190

URL: http://svn.apache.org/viewvc?rev=652190&view=rev
Log:
Fix for bug I introduced while refactoring the inventory reservation service to improve its performance.

Modified:
    ofbiz/trunk/applications/product/script/org/ofbiz/product/inventory/InventoryReserveServices.xml

Modified: ofbiz/trunk/applications/product/script/org/ofbiz/product/inventory/InventoryReserveServices.xml
URL: http://svn.apache.org/viewvc/ofbiz/trunk/applications/product/script/org/ofbiz/product/inventory/InventoryReserveServices.xml?rev=652190&r1=652189&r2=652190&view=diff
==============================================================================
--- ofbiz/trunk/applications/product/script/org/ofbiz/product/inventory/InventoryReserveServices.xml (original)
+++ ofbiz/trunk/applications/product/script/org/ofbiz/product/inventory/InventoryReserveServices.xml Tue Apr 29 16:51:23 2008
@@ -84,8 +84,8 @@
                 <entity-condition entity-name="InventoryItemAndLocation" list-name="inventoryItemAndLocations">
                     <condition-list combine="and">
                         <condition-expr field-name="productId" env-name="parameters.productId"/>
-                        <condition-expr field-name="facilityId" env-name="parameters.facilityId" ignore-if-null="true"/>
-                        <condition-expr field-name="containerId" env-name="parameters.containerId" ignore-if-null="true"/>
+                        <condition-expr field-name="facilityId" env-name="parameters.facilityId" ignore-if-empty="true" ignore-if-null="true"/>
+                        <condition-expr field-name="containerId" env-name="parameters.containerId" ignore-if-empty="true" ignore-if-null="true"/>
                         <condition-expr field-name="quantityOnHandTotal" operator="greater" value="0.0"/>
                         <condition-expr field-name="locationTypeEnumId" operator="equals" value="FLT_PICKLOC"/>
                     </condition-list>
@@ -104,8 +104,8 @@
                     <entity-condition entity-name="InventoryItemAndLocation" list-name="inventoryItemAndLocations">
                         <condition-list combine="and">
                             <condition-expr field-name="productId" env-name="parameters.productId"/>
-                            <condition-expr field-name="facilityId" env-name="parameters.facilityId" ignore-if-null="true"/>
-                            <condition-expr field-name="containerId" env-name="parameters.containerId" ignore-if-null="true"/>
+                            <condition-expr field-name="facilityId" env-name="parameters.facilityId" ignore-if-empty="true" ignore-if-null="true"/>
+                            <condition-expr field-name="containerId" env-name="parameters.containerId" ignore-if-empty="true" ignore-if-null="true"/>
                             <condition-expr field-name="quantityOnHandTotal" operator="greater" value="0.0"/>
                             <condition-expr field-name="locationTypeEnumId" operator="equals" value="FLT_BULK"/>
                         </condition-list>
@@ -125,8 +125,8 @@
                     <entity-condition entity-name="InventoryItem" list-name="inventoryItems">
                         <condition-list combine="and">
                             <condition-expr field-name="productId" env-name="parameters.productId"/>
-                            <condition-expr field-name="facilityId" env-name="parameters.facilityId" ignore-if-null="true"/>
-                            <condition-expr field-name="containerId" env-name="parameters.containerId" ignore-if-null="true"/>
+                            <condition-expr field-name="facilityId" env-name="parameters.facilityId" ignore-if-empty="true" ignore-if-null="true"/>
+                            <condition-expr field-name="containerId" env-name="parameters.containerId" ignore-if-empty="true" ignore-if-null="true"/>
                             <condition-expr field-name="quantityOnHandTotal" operator="greater" value="0.0"/>
                             <condition-expr field-name="locationSeqId" operator="equals" env-name="nullField"/>
                         </condition-list>